Official Information
PEEK
Take a look at an opponent's inventory! See HELP LOOK for details on how to
use this.
Peek is available to:
Thieves : level 3. Any Alignment.
Player-Supplied Information
- Only a portion of the player's inventory is revealed per time you peek at them. In order to get a full idea of what they are carrying, it is necessary to peek at them several times. - Ink, added 05/24/2012
